Continental Airlines has launched a new checked bag policy to help defray rising fuel costs. Customers who purchase economy-class tickets with certain fare types, and are not Elite members of Continental’s OnePass frequent flier programme, may check one bag at no charge and a second bag for a US$25 service fee.
Continental’s premium travellers in economy class may check two bags at no charge. It said checked bags must meet weight and size restrictions or will be subject to additional fees.
The policy will apply immediately for destinations within the U.S., Puerto Rico, the U.S. Virgin Islands and Canada for travel commencing on or after 5 May.
